What Questions Should I Ask About Inpatient Alcohol and Drug Rehab in Centerpoint, Indiana?

To ensure that you have the most ideal outcome from time spent in an inpatient drug and alcohol rehab facility, there are some questions that you might want to inquire about. The answers you receive will help you decide which facility has the most ideal program for your particular alcohol and drug abuse problem and drug and alcohol addiction.

These questions include:

1. Is the Program Specific?

Inquire if the Centerpoint facility is meant for specific populations and individuals. This is because there are some extremely specialized inpatient alcohol and drug treatment centers for women, LGBTQ+ individuals, men, young individuals, teens, and the elderly - among many others. Other programs, however, might have a more diverse population of clients.

In case you have some special needs due to your identity and the fact that you identify with a particular group, you may find greater success attending a rehabilitation facility that caters to that particular demographic.

2. Which Addictions Does It Treat?

In case you are addicted to heroin, you may recover much quicker if you take part in a facility that specifically caters to this type of substance use and addiction. This is because there are various types of addictive, mind-altering, and intoxicating substances and each demands a specific kind of rehabilitation.

3. How are The Accommodations?

Although accommodations might not be as vital as the type of rehab you will receive, it might still be quite important. This is because you may not want to feel uncomfortable with the space you live in on top of the discomfort arising from your addiction rehab.

In many instances, inpatient alcohol and drug rehab in Centerpoint, IN. may last longer than a few months. Therefore, you need to ensure that the accommodations at the center you select can meet all your needs and that your environment will feel positive and empower your recovery.

In a luxury inpatient facility, for instance, you may benefit from resort-like experiences and accommodations. These centers also provide a number of different amenities and services which can make it easier for you to conquer your drug and alcohol abuse and drug and alcohol addiction.
